只是为了澄清我的目标。我输入"谁指导终结者2?"进入谷歌并在页面顶部有一个框,上面写着詹姆斯卡梅隆等。我想要这些信息。
我检查了代码,<div class="_eF">James Cameron</div>
是我想要的div。我可以通过CURL请求抓住这个并选择这个div,但它很慢。如果我想运行多个CURL请求,可能会导致相对较长的等待时间。
当然有更有效的方法来实现这一目标吗?
我试过寻找谷歌搜索API的东西,我似乎找到的是你可以放在你的网页上的自定义搜索引擎。我需要能够在运行时将这些信息输入我的PHP脚本。
答案 0 :(得分:0)
使用simple_html_dom并在页面的每个div中搜索...您可以使用file_get_contents()
获取页面的html,但我不知道谷歌是否批准该页面。